In this work we will study the Bessel Differential Equation and its resolution using the Frobenius
method, thus obtaining the solutions of the First and Second Kind of Bessel Functions. The motivation for the study object of this work arose because Bessel's Ordinary Differential Equation is one of the most important Ordinary Differential Equations in advanced studies of mathematics applied to Physics and Engineering. This study was developed in a bibliographical sequence, higher education books on Differentiable Equations with Application in Modeling, scientific articles and academic works were used as a research source for bibliographical complementation. Initially, we recalled some concepts considered prerequisites to the topic of the work, then several important topics were covered about the power series method, which is a fundamental tool for obtaining the solution of a differential equation. Subsequently, based on the content exposed in the initial chapters, the Bessel Differential Equation was solved and, thus, the First and Second Species Functions were obtained and in the final part an application that can be found in [11] was shown. Finally, the present work contributes to the presentation of teaching material that complements the study of Ordinary Second Order Differential Equations and serves as support for the development of knowledge about Bessel Functions. |
